&lt;p&gt;&lt;b&gt;New page&lt;/b&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;div&gt;WISSEL, Fred G.(Ascaffenburg, Germany--Dubuque, IA, Oct. 17, 1961). Butcher.  Wissel was a lifelong butcher in Dubuque and operated Wissel&amp;#039;s Market at 19th and Jackson for fifty-two years. At one time, his family lived in the house adjoining the market. He was later employed at the Dubuque Storage and Transfer Company.  His son, [[WISSEL, Cyril|Cyril WISSEL]] was one of the founders of H &amp;amp; W Motor Express Company and president of Dubuque Storage and Transfer Company.&lt;br /&gt;
